Smelling Salts, Gentlemen, & Royal Attitudes

A while back on someone's blog, sorry I've forgotten which one, I saw the PBS Masterpiece Special, Downton Abbey introduced.  The show seemed intriquing, but now I'm hooked.  This past Sunday I missed it since we were coming back from the show, but I found that I can watch the previous episode online and thought I'd share it with you:


Watch the full episode. See more Masterpiece.

The scenery is just beautiful and you feel as if you are right there.  The series was filmed at Highclere Castle in Berkshire that was used as Downton Abbey, with the servants' living areas constructed and filmed at Ealing Studios.

The village of Bampton in Oxfordshire was used for filming the outdoor scenes, most notably St Mary's Church and the village library, which became the entrance to the cottage hospital (a cottage hospital~only during this time period would this have sounded cute).
